Timeout

Aleksandr aberon at medialt.ru
Tue Apr 25 16:50:10 MSD 2006


Здравствуйте, Igor.

Вы писали 25 апреля 2006 г., 17:42:58:

> On Tue, 25 Apr 2006, Aleksandr wrote:

>> Ситуация такая, заливаем файл на медленном канале, файлы размером до 4
>> мб заливаются нормально. Если заливаем файл метров 7, то сначло идет
>> заливка, затем показывается просто пустая страница. Я так понимаю что
>> не хватает времени на заливку, но всю операцию не затрачивается даже 5
>> минут, но все равно заливка не происходит. Подскажите как можно решить
>> проблему. Если заливать на быстром канале, то файлы даже 20 метров
>> нормально заливаются.
>>
>> Настройки вот такие:
>> sendfile        on;
>> send_timeout    10m;
>> tcp_nopush     on;
>> tcp_nodelay    on;
>> send_lowat      12000;
>>
>> client_max_body_size       100m;
>> client_body_buffer_size    128k;

> Нужно включить лог на уровне info и посмотреть, что в такие моменты пишется
> в лог.

В этот момент в логе появляется вот такое сообщение:
2006/04/25 16:45:23 [crit] 11348#0: *2 sendfile() failed (9: Bad file descriptor) while sending request to upstream,

> Можно поставить что-нибудь вроде:
> client_body_timeout  5m;
> http://sysoev.ru/nginx/docs/http/ngx_http_core_module.html#client_body_timeout

Попробывал не помогло.

-- 
С уважением,
 Aleksandr                          mailto:aberon at medialt.ru






More information about the nginx-ru mailing list